Barb vs. the Leech Queen features Barb and Porkchop in a cutthroat competition in this action-packed and uproariously funny fourth book in the Barb the Last Berzerker middle grade graphic novel series, perfect for fans of How to Train Your Dragon and Dog Man.
With the war between the humans and monsters finally over, the Berzerkers are now fighting to preserve the fragile peace in the land of Bailiwick. When Barb and Porkchop arrive in the city of Skulladune, they find monsters and people at each other’s throats over the silliest things and do their best to shut the conflict down.
But there’s a sinister shapeshifting force at work who seeks to possess the Ghost Blade, and she manipulates Barb into entering Skulladune’s notoriously brutal contest to become the city’s marshal and then tricks Porkchop into entering too. Soon, the Berzerker and the yeti are facing an evil gelatinous cube, a sewer labyrinth, an epic sausage-eating contest, and more.
Can the best friends find a way to work together, or will they be forced to take each other out?

About the Author
For the past ten years, award-winning duo Dan Abdo and Jason Patterson have developed numerous animated campaigns, network TV and web series, and critically acclaimed commercial work. Their extensive portfolio has garnered them industry wide recognition, while their humorous sensibility and diverse skill set have landed them jobs for top global brands. Dan and Jason have set up properties at Twentieth Century Fox, Disney, and Nickelodeon as well as a feature animated film through Paramount Pictures. The well-versed storytellers have developed original content for a wide variety of platforms, including print (Nickelodeon Comics, The New Yorker), theater (Pilobolus), and digital.
